• DocumentCode
    3298638
  • Title

    A FPGA based modular coincidence arbitrator design for Compton camera with multiple detection blocks

  • Author

    Han, Li ; Huh, Sam S. ; Clinthorne, Neal H.

  • Volume
    5
  • fYear
    2005
  • fDate
    23-29 Oct. 2005
  • Firstpage
    2949
  • Lastpage
    2953
  • Abstract
    A field programmable gate array (FPGA) based modular coincidence arbitrator has been designed for the new generation of Compton camera which involves multiple scattering and absorbing detection blocks. Compared with the conventional coincidence trigger generator realized by TAC-SCA modules or separated logic gates, the proposed FPGA design increases the flexibility for coincidence window length adjustment and enables online updates of the look-up-table listing the different combinations of detection blocks that need to be triggered under different inputs. Furthermore, the FPGA design reduces the redevelopment time for modifying detection blocks by using independent function modules. In this design, the coincidence arbitrator is composed of one central control module, several detector coincidence (SD) modules, and one communication module. The central controller is employed to initialize the coincidence window, synchronize the difference detector modules, arbitrate the system coincidence, and trigger the corresponding detection blocks. The SD module, associated with one corresponding detection block, is employed to initialize pulse-delay-timer, delays the pulse generated by the external detector and judges whether that delayed pulse in within the coincidence window. The communication block transmits the states and controllable parameters between the arbitrator and the host PC via the USB port. All the functions of a multiple modular coincidence arbitrator are implemented by the Xilinx Spartan-3 FPGA at the working frequency of 100 MHz
  • Keywords
    coincidence circuits; coincidence techniques; field programmable gate arrays; imaging; nuclear electronics; particle detectors; 100 MHz; Compton camera; TAC-SCA modules; USB port; Xilinx Spartan-3 FPGA; central controller; coincidence trigger generator; coincidence window length adjustment; communication module; difference detector modules; field programmable gate array based modular coincidence arbitrator; look-up-table; multiple scattering absorbing detection blocks; nuclear imaging; pulse-delay-timer; Cameras; Centralized control; Communication system control; Delay; Detectors; Field programmable gate arrays; Logic design; Logic gates; Programmable logic arrays; Scattering;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Nuclear Science Symposium Conference Record, 2005 IEEE
  • Conference_Location
    Fajardo
  • ISSN
    1095-7863
  • Print_ISBN
    0-7803-9221-3
  • Type

    conf

  • DOI
    10.1109/NSSMIC.2005.1596950
  • Filename
    1596950